Kyiv's Strength Shines Through Power Outages and Bitter Cold Following Russian Strikes

Russia’s Intensified Attacks on Ukraine’s Energy Infrastructure

In the past few weeks, Ukraine has experienced an alarming escalation in attacks on its energy infrastructure by Russia. This has resulted in widespread power outages across Kyiv, making this winter one of the most challenging in recent history. With nearly half a million residents having evacuated the capital, those who remain are grappling with prolonged disruptions to essential services such as heat, electricity, and water.

The Consequences of Energy Attacks

The continued assaults have led to dire conditions for the citizens. Power cuts have become a common sight, affecting everyday life and creating uncertainty regarding basic needs. The freezing temperatures combined with these outages have placed immense strain on families, with many forced to rely on alternate heating sources or emergency shelters.

Impact on Daily Life

  • Heating Shortages: Many residents are struggling to keep warm, as the lack of reliable heating can lead to health risks, especially for vulnerable populations.
  • Water Supply Issues: Interruptions in power have meant that water supply systems are also affected, further complicating the living situation.
  • Electricity Outages: Frequent blackouts have disrupted communication, work, and education, creating a major hurdle for those trying to maintain normality in their lives.
